Much better! The tiny bright spot, outside of the text reading area? Yes it could be a light guide defect, or these bright spots sometimes happen from screen damage also. You may not be able to feel screen damage with your finger.

If you are certain that the Kobo came that way from the start, and it bothers you enough, (and you haven't (for example) had your keys hit it - has it been protected in a case the whole time?) - then by all means ask for an exchange. "Light guide defect" is the wording you're looking for. Not "damage".
